Most pills need one full week of taking it at the same time each day before you are protected. Sounds like you should be okay. Read your information leaflet inside your pill pack and see what it says about when you are fully protected. If you threw that out, Google your pill brand and read about it there.Keeping in mind that the pill must be taken at the same time every day to be 99.9% effective, you still have a .01% chance to get pregnant, but it's very rare.
